Newsflash! Agencies Use Other Agencies’ Work In Portfolio

pocket_hercules1.gif

Certainly this practice is not a new one but one Minneapolis Adrants reader took note of the new agency Pocket Hercules’ use of its founders work done while they were at Carmichael Lynch and wrote, “You didn’t hear it from me. (Minneapolis is a small town) You should look at the site of the agency started by super star creatives from Carmichael Lynch. pockethercules.com Their marketing strategy is ” little agency vs. big holding company agency.” But then look at the work they have on the site. It’s all Carmichael Lynch work. (GREAT CL work) Now, I’m no lawyer, but isn’t it illegal to use another shop’s work even if you worked there? Anyway, I thought it was ironic.”

We don’t think it’s illegal and we’re sure someone will tell us if it is but what agency on the planet hasn’t done this before?
